原文:buff/cache占用过高的问题

工作记录 默认是 ,不清除缓冲区缓存和页面缓存 可用值 到 值越高系统上的程序会跑起来越慢 蛋疼的是这只是一次性的,所以要写个脚本放定时器每天自动跑自动清理 脚本 设置定时任务 从左到右分别是分钟 小时 日 月份 星期 转载请注明博客出处:http: www.cnblogs.com cjh notes ...

2019-06-08 22:30 0 1992 推荐指数:

查看详情

解决 linux 下 buff/cache 占用过高问题

使用定时器: 执行:crontab -e 然后在配置文件中加入 如下配置,半小时执行一次 buff/cache 释放*/30 * * * * sync && echo 1 > /proc/sys/vm/drop_caches*/30 * * * * sync ...

Sat Apr 24 09:13:00 CST 2021 0 421
buff/cache 占用过大问题

什么是buffer cache Buffer cache则主要是设计用来在系统对块设备进行读写的时候,对块进行数据缓存的系统来使用。这意味着某些对块的操作会使用buffer cache进行缓存,比如我们在格式化文件系统的时候。一般情况下两个缓存系统是一起配合使用的,比如当我们对一个文件进行写操作 ...

Mon Jan 17 02:08:00 CST 2022 0 920
buff/cache 占用过高解决方法

cache 读磁盘时,数据从磁盘读出后,暂留在缓冲区(cache),为后续程序的使用做准备 buffer 写磁盘时,先保存到磁盘缓冲区(buffer),然后再写入到磁盘 三条命令: #echo 1 > /proc/sys/vm/drop_caches #echo 2 > ...

Tue Jun 08 01:15:00 CST 2021 0 2281
Linux中buff-cache占用过高解决方案

我们在使用free -h查看系统内存的时候,有时间会发现buff/cache很高 available 表示应用程序可以申请到的内存 什么是buff buff(Buffer Cache)是一种I/O缓存,用于内存和硬盘的缓冲,是io设备的读写缓冲区。根据磁盘 ...

Sat Aug 07 07:54:00 CST 2021 0 389
Linux中buff/cache内存占用过高解决办法

在Linux系统中,我们经常用free命令来查看系统内存的使用状态。在一个centos7的系统上,free命令的显示内容大概是这样一个状态: 这个命令几乎是每一个使用过Linux的人必会的命令,但越是这样的命令,似乎真正明白的人越少(我是说比例越少)。一般情况下,对此命令输出 ...

Mon Oct 21 18:04:00 CST 2019 0 4146
buff/cache内存占用过

通过free -m 查看到 buff/cache的值比较大,导致可使用的内存有120M左右了 通过下面的命令,清除缓存 References linux buff/cache过大,清理脚本 buff/cache内存占用过多 ...

Sun Aug 11 23:34:00 CST 2019 0 880
Python3 os.walk()函数导致buffer/cache占用过高问题处理

一、背景说明 os.walk()应该是当前python中遍历目录最推荐的函数,之前用python写了一个用于收集系统用到的第三方组件的脚本,在测试时使用os.walk()遍历了部分目录,并通过了全网的测试。但在改成遍历根目录后,被业务反馈说脚本占用内存过高导致了内存告警。 在直观感觉上,只遍历 ...

Wed Jun 24 03:48:00 CST 2020 0 606
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M